Customised Door Installation: Enhancing Your Home's Aesthetic and Functionality
Customised door installation is among the most effective ways to enhance the aesthetics and functionality of a home. With a growing pattern towards personalisation in home enhancement, property owners are significantly going with customised doors that reflect their private design and satisfy particular requirements. This post explores the benefits of customised door installation, the numerous types offered, and what to consider when starting such a project.
Benefits of Customised Door Installation
Customised doors not just serve practical functions however also contribute significantly to the total appearance of a home. Here are some of the crucial advantages:

A range of custom door alternatives are readily available, allowing house owners to choose based upon their special design and requirements. Some popular types include:
1. Entry Doors
These doors are the first impression of your home and can be customised in numerous styles, finishes, and materials.
2. Interior Doors
Interior doors can be developed to develop connection within the home or to stand apart as a feature. Options consist of bi-fold, pocket, or traditional panel doors.
3. Outdoor Patio and Sliding Doors
These doors use a seamless shift from indoor to outside areas and can be customised to optimise views and maximize the natural light.
4. Security Doors
Customised security doors provide distinct designs while ensuring security through enhanced products and locking mechanisms.
5. Garage Doors
Custom garage doors can reflect the architectural style of the home, using products like wood composites or vinyl for sturdiness and style.
6. Biometric and Smart Doors
For the tech-savvy house owner, clever doors can be geared up with the most recent innovation for enhanced security and benefit.
Steps to Consider for Customised Door Installation
When embarking on a customised door installation project, a systematic approach ought to be taken to ensure the best results. Below is a step-by-step guide:

A: The installation time can vary based upon the door type and the intricacy of the project, generally ranging from a few hours to a couple of days.
Q2: Are customised doors more pricey than off-the-shelf alternatives?
A: Yes, customised doors normally cost more due to personalised styles, materials, and professional installation. Nevertheless, they are typically worth the investment for their unique aesthetic appeals and performance.
Q3: Can I install a customised door myself?
A: While some property owners might pick to install their own doors, it is typically advised to work with professionals to ensure an appropriate fit and finish, especially with customised styles.
Q4: What maintenance is needed for customised doors?
A: Maintenance mainly depends upon the product. For wood doors, regular sealing and covering may be required, while fiberglass and metal might need less maintenance.
Q5: Are customised doors energy effective?
A: Custom doors can be created with energy performance in mind, utilizing insulation and weather sealing to decrease energy loss and improve convenience.
